Key Steps for a Lasting Outdoor Paint Job
To ensure your deck or porch looks stunning through summer and beyond, preparation and proper product selection are crucial. Here’s what homeowners in Woodlake, Tuckahoe, and surrounding neighborhoods should keep in mind:
Inspect and Repair First
Before painting, check for loose boards, popped nails, or water damage. Addressing repairs early prolongs the life of your investment and ensures a seamless finish.
Deep Clean for Better Results
Power or soft washing removes embedded dirt, algae, and mildew, creating a clean canvas for paint or stain to adhere. A&A Painting Services LLC offers soft wash solutions ideal for delicate wood surfaces.
Choose the Right Paint or Stain
Select weather-resistant, UV-protected products for Virginia’s changing climate. Lighter shades reflect heat, keeping surfaces cooler during those festive backyard events.
Trending Question: Can You Paint a Deck Without Removing Old Paint?
A common concern from homeowners in Richmond and Short Pump is whether you must strip old paint first. If existing paint is peeling or flaking, it’s essential to remove it to ensure proper adhesion. If the old paint is intact and well-adhered, a thorough cleaning and light sanding will usually suffice before applying a new coat. Professional painters know how to assess and prep each surface for best results.

Maintenance Made Simple
After your deck or porch is freshly painted, maintaining its beauty throughout the season is easier with a few proactive steps:
- Sweep away debris weekly to prevent scratches and mildew.
- Rinse gently with a garden hose as needed.
- Reapply a maintenance coat every 2-3 years or as recommended for your chosen finish.
